- Traditional and welcoming pub site at the foot of the Malvern Hills
- Three miles from the Three Counties Showground
- Dogs welcome on site and in the pub; menu of Indian street food

- Under 18s must be accompanied by their parents or legal guardians.
- Your dog must be tattooed or microchipped.
- The site does not accept breeds/crossbreeds listed in the Dangerous Dogs Act (i.e. XL Bully, Pit Bull Terrier, Japanese Tosa, Dogo Argentino, and Fila Brasileiro).
- No hen/stag parties permitted via Pitchup.com.
- The bar and/or restaurant is open between 01/01 et 31/12.
- No cars/motorbikes by the pitch/unit. All cars must be parked in the designated area.
- Guests are advised to bring a good quality torch with them as parts of the site are unlit.
- Children under the age of 10 are not allowed in the bar area unless dining with an adult. The pub is open Tuesday to Thursday between 12pm - 10.45pm and Friday to Sunday between 12pm and 12am. Food is served Tuesday to Sunday between 12pm - 8.45pm. The pub is closed on Mondays. It is highly recommended that you book a table in advance due to limited availability.

Small, friendly pub with great service and food! The hard standing pitches…
Electric hardstanding and grass touring pitch
Liked Small, friendly pub with great service and food! The hard standing pitches were a good size with electric hook up. Washing facility were basic and practical. Toilets were inside, we didn't use the showers but the toilets were perfectly fine.
The food in the pub was fantastic and considering we booked a table for 9 people and there were lots of other tables booked it was brilliant service. Lively atmosphere with beer garden which music was played in throughout the day which we like (husband was very happy with the large tv playing the rugby in the sofa area! Son was very happy with the pool table). Also very dog friendly and the fact you can take your pup in the pub for drinks and food is so handy, esp if weather isnt great. Lovely location with a walking trail perfect for dogs across the road over the field. Something for everyone here. Liked the notice with the distance to shops and number for takeaway services who would deliver to the pub, thoughtful and handy.
Ignore the bad reviews, some people seem to be petty and moan about anything. It all depends what you are looking for but the pictures and description are a good idea of what to expect.
Thanks for a great time - we shall be back for short weekends frequently.
